Hi all
I'm experiencing something weird, I use distcc over a couple of boxes using
fedora, both of them crash every once in a while if compiling something
remotelly. But it seems to happen only when the sender is my box running
2.6.4-rc1-mm1 kernel, not tried other 2.6 kernels, but with 2.4.25 nothing
bad happened.
The fedora kernel version is 2.4.22-1.2149.nptl.
I know this is not the correct list to ask problems about fedora, but maybe
someone knows what can be happening, and what can I do to trace the problem
down. Should I try to install a vanilla kernel to see if that corrects the
problem ?

One of the fedora mailing lists would be a better place to post.
Do you have SELinux enabled?
Try and get a log of the kernel oops via serial console, or at least write
down the traceback functions.
